How do you fix a flat down comforter?
Shake and Fluff
Grab the comforter from the bottom edge and shake it firmly several times, then repeat the process from the top end of the comforter. Shaking it vertically, rather than horizontally, allows both the down and the fabric baffle walls to realign, resulting in a fluffier, more comfortable comforter.

Place the down comforter alone into the dryer with two to three clean tennis balls. Turn the dryer to a medium or low setting and run it for 30 minutes. Remove the comforter and inspect it for any remaining clumps. Continue to run the dryer for 30 minute increments until the lumps are eliminated.How do you redistribute down?
In some cases, your down may clump in one area, such as a corner. The best way to handle this is to work the specific area by either gently massaging the down clusters or by lightly smacking and pushing the area. You also can put your sleep system in the dryer on the NO HEAT setting with a few tennis balls.How do you redistribute feathers down comforter?

How do you plump a duvet?
To ensure optimum filling and resilience in the duvet's down or feathers, you should shake your duvet every day. If you discover that the duvet is not as plump as before, it may be that moisture had filled the air holes. You can get the duvet to rise again by tumble-drying it with one or two drying tennis balls.What can you put in the dryer with a down comforter?

A higher fill power will give you a lighter, more fluffy comforter for a given warmth level. Fill weight is the main driver of warmth. It is simply the number of ounces of down in a comforter. As more down is put into the comforter the warmth level increases.
